Most existing methods of administering eye drops rely on patients holding the eye drop bottle and suspending it in the air, which can cause arm fatigue and make it difficult to accurately drop the drops into the eye, posing a risk of inaccurate drop placement.
An eye drop assembly has been designed, including a first ear bracket, a second ear bracket, an elastic band, a frame, a nose pad, a transparent cover, a fixing rod, a spring, a connecting rod, a pull ring, a slide, a mounting plate, and a support plate. By combining these components, the eyeball can be opened and the eye drops can be accurately dripped without holding the eye drop bottle.
It improves the accuracy and convenience of medication administration, avoids arm fatigue, enhances the labor-saving and safety aspects of the infusion operation, and reduces the risk of cross-infection.

[0021] Example 1
[0022] Please see Figures 1 to 5This utility model provides a technical solution: an eye drop assembly, including a first ear bracket 1 and a second ear bracket 2, with an elastic band 3 shared between the first ear bracket 1 and the second ear bracket 2. A frame 4 is installed on one side of both the first ear bracket 1 and the second ear bracket 2, and a nose pad 5 is shared between the two frames 4. A transparent cover 6 is installed on the front side of both frames 4, and an eye drop bottle 7 is threadedly connected to the center of the interior of each of the two transparent covers 6. Two symmetrical fixing rods 8 are installed inside each of the two frames 4, and two symmetrical springs 9 are installed on both sides of the interior of each of the two frames 4. Two symmetrical connecting rods 10 are movably connected inside the frames 4. Each end is equipped with a pull ring 11, which is located on the outside of the frame 4. The other end of each of the two connecting rods 10 is equipped with a slide block 12. The spring 9 is located outside the fixed rod 8, and one end of the spring 9 is connected to the slide block 12. The slide block 12 has a through hole inside, corresponding to the position of the fixed rod 8. Each of the two slide blocks 12 has a mounting plate 13 installed on one side, and each of the two mounting plates 13 has a support plate 14 installed on one side. The size of the support plate 14 is larger than that of the mounting plate 13, and the support plate 14 protrudes from one side of the frame 4. Both the mounting plate 13 and the support plate 14 are arc-shaped structures. The outside of the support plate 14 is provided with a disposable soft pad 15, which is made of rubber.
[0023] When applying eye drops, first hang the first ear bracket 1 and the second ear bracket 2 on the ears so that the two frames 4 are located at the two eyes, and the nose pad 5 is located at the bridge of the nose. The support plates 14 set at the top and bottom of the two frames 4 are located at the user's upper and lower eyes respectively. The disposable soft pad 15 contacts the user's eye skin and presses lightly. The disposable soft pad 15 can be replaced to prevent cross-infection. The whole device can be reused, and the disposable soft pad 15 can improve the user's comfort.
[0024] When administering eye drops, the user first threads the eye drop bottle 7 into the inside of the transparent cover 6, and then selects the eye to which the drops need to be administered. The user holds the two pull rings 11 located at the top and bottom of a frame 4 and pulls them outwards simultaneously. The two pull rings 11 simultaneously move the slide 12 and the mounting plate 13 installed on one side through the connecting rod 10. The slide 12 slides outside the two fixed rods 8 and compresses the spring 9, widening the distance between the two mounting plates 13 according to the user's situation. The opening plate 14 on one side of the two mounting plates 13 opens the patient's eye. When the eyeball is exposed, the user can squeeze the eye drop bottle 7 to drip the liquid into the opened eyeball. After the liquid is successfully dripped, the user releases the pull rings 11, and the slide 12 springs back to its original position through the spring 9.
